National Wheelchair Softball Tournament

The National Wheelchair Softball Tournament (NWSA) is held every year at different locations throughout the country. There have been many dynasties as well a gradual increase in the level of competition and number of teams participating.

Today, the NWST brings more than just competition for national title, it brings the entire wheelchair softball community together to showcase their talents in a new city.

2006 National Wheelchair Softball Tournament

The 2006 national champions RIC Cubs played host for the 30th NWST in the great city of Chicago. The tournament took place August 9-13, 2006.

2005 National Wheelchair Softball Tournament

The 2005 NWST was hosted in the city of Columbus, Ohio under the direction of John Wall and Jerry Jones. It was the second time in four years the city host this annual competition.

NWST All-Tournament Selections

Since the first national tournament, the NWSA has kept track of all the national tournament award recipients and all tournament selections.  In 1996, the NWSA began to honor teams in the consolation bracket and dubbed it Division II.
